Here's everything you need to know about Manchester City's midfield targets with more than just Elliot Anderson under consideration:

Elliot Anderson is Manchester City's top target this summer having been identified as a long-term option in the middle of midfield.

City are in talks with Nottingham Forest over a potential move for the former Newcastle United man, who is currently at the World Cup with England. The two clubs need to agree a fee and there has been speculation it could pass the £100m mark.

England boss Thomas Tuchel has said players will be allowed to complete medicals and deals while on international duty. "It's about common sense," he said. "I would not like [transfers on] the day before a match, or on a matchday, that's the policy. Maybe two days before too, but let's see. But everything else - if it's done privately, efficiently and quietly - then we are always happy to help. It helps to have clarity around any player. If anyone has a chance to complete a change of club we will not stand in their way."

It's not just Anderson that City have an interest in. Newcastle midfielder Sandro Tonali is a potential target with the Italian catching the eye at St James' Park.

City could sign more than one central midfielder with any prospective move for Tonali not dependent on what happens with Anderson.

There is uncertainty around Rodri, Nico Gonzalez, Mateo Kovacic and Tijjani Reijnders, so City have plans in place to move for reinforcements should they need to.
